There's no fraking around anymore, this time it's all or nothing for both sides. This is one of the best and darkest two parters in the Power Rangers franchise, part one definitely takes a really unfun turn where we see for once the good guys actually lose.

We see all over the galaxy that there are bad guys that are just invading and taking over on all fronts and our planet is next on their list. I'll admit seeing all this happening really made me worried not just whether the Power Rangers will triumph but if any will be able to survive. Sure they've fought against big odds before but this is totally different because this in an invasion force they have to deal with, and this isn't just another typical battle it's full scale war.

The battle we see is just great when we see the Power Rangers come down to earth to fight and we are seeing them giving it their all, beating the crap out of the baddies that are left and right, back and forward just covering every space on the planet. One highlight of the battle is seeing Andros using his Super Power Mode where he is flying around and firing missiles at some of Astronima's forces and he takes a good number down and helps Ashley. We even see Zane use the Mega Winger and like King Kong is trying to swat down the armada planes.

But despite there efforts they turn out to be fruitless as they've been overwhelmed and we see one by one each of them go down. It was so disheartening, because most times you expect the Power Rangers would triumph but this is not one of those times. So the Rangers are forced to fall back, and we see a cinematography shot where two of the Rangers Carlos and Cassie are running from a horde of solders after them, this really added to the disheartening feeling just showing that evil for once actually triumphs.

Another scene that adds to the disheartened is a campfire scene when some of the Angel Grove citizens start losing faith in the Power Rangers. The highlight to this scene is seeing both Bulk and Skull give a little speech about the Power Rangers to lift their spirits, it was interesting seeing that showing how unwavered their faith in the Raingers are and it makes since since both have been with the Raingers for the longest time, even thought they didn't know it. But what's disheartening about the seen is we see one of the Rangers pass by hearing this then walking away; the Power Rangers are already here but their not going to be able to save anyone.

Round One goes to the bad guys. Zero to the Rangers and all that is good.
